ошибка "Обращение к процедуре объекта как к функции" после перехода на 8.3 #786166


#0 by Shur1cIT
УПП модуль обычного приложения обновил платформу на 8.3 работаем в режиме совместимости. Вылетает ошибка: {}: Обращение к процедуре объекта как к функции (Записать)   вот сама процедура Процедура ПолучитьВнешниеКомпонентыПриНеобходимости
#1 by Живой Ископаемый
быть как ты?
#2 by Shur1cIT
не дописал, от записать не какого присваивания нет тоесть она не как функция вызываеться от неё не пытаюсь ни чего получить почему он ругаетьсся? плюс процедура типовая УПП шная
#3 by Живой Ископаемый
какой тип у значения НаборЗаписей[0].ХранилищеФайла.Получить ?
#4 by Shur1cIT
двоичные данные
#5 by Живой Ископаемый
а можешь сделать из этой строки: вот такие ТРИ: ?
#6 by Shur1cIT
извиняюсь за задержку двДанные.Записать(имяФайла); сыпеться точно такаеже ошибка, в 8.3 небыло недокуметированых изменений??? хотя я же в режиме совместимости работаю должно всё ок быть
#7 by Lexey_
ошибка хоть от этой строки?
#8 by Mankubus
эту строку не в отладчике выполняешь?
#9 by Shur1cIT
Свойство    Значение    Тип двДанные.Записать(имяФайла)    {}: Обращение к процедуре объекта как к функции (Записать) в отладчике
#10 by Shur1cIT
точнее у меня отладка по ошибке стоит и потом второй раз уже сам проверяю
#11 by Cool_Profi
"эту строку не в отладчике выполняешь?" Вот и ответ. Отладчик своё выражение считает как вызов функции, а не процедуры.
#12 by Shur1cIT
так у меня по ошибке он сам без точки остановки вылетает
#13 by Shur1cIT
#14 by Lexey_
с этого и надо было начинать, текст ошибки в не имеет отношения к проблеме, добавь в исключение Сообщить(ОписаниеОшибки);
#15 by Fedor-1971
двДанные - проверь отладчиком тип. Может там не ДвоичныеДанные и права, куда пытаешься Записать у пользователя сервера 1С
Тэги:
Ответить:
Комментарии доступны только авторизированным пользователям

В этой группе 1С